Stephen Curry and Ayesha Curry were recognized with the 2026 Muhammad Ali Sports Humanitarian Award for their work with the Eat. Learn. Play. Foundation in Oakland. Launched in 2019, the foundation focuses on providing healthy meals, quality education, and safe spaces for children. Since its inception, the foundation has served over 35 million meals, invested $20 million in literacy programs, distributed over one million books, and transformed school facilities. The award highlights the couple's commitment to community development beyond their basketball careers, emphasizing collaboration with local institutions and donors.
